The DistinctionWhat "Solid Wood Door" Actually Means (And What It Doesn't)
The phrase "wood door" covers an enormous range of quality, and most of it isn't wood at all. Walk through any home center and you'll find doors labeled "wood" that are actually veneer skins glued over medium-density fiberboard, particleboard, or polyurethane foam cores. They look like wood from across the room. They're priced like entry-level products. And they will not perform like solid wood over time.
True solid wood — what the trade calls true timber — is milled from solid pieces of raw lumber. This lumber comprises the full thickness of the door. No fillers, no veneers over MDF, no foam cores or shortcuts. At RealCraft, every door starts as rough-sawn hardwood, milled to 2 inches or thicker, joined with mortise and tenon construction where a tenon fits into a precisely cut mortise pocket. That's the traditional standard for strength, and it requires specialized skills and machinery. [Manufacturers focused on cutting costs don't have patience for specialized skills.](/blogs/articles/who-still-makes-solid-wood-doors-and-why-it-matters)
Why does this matter for the comparison? Because a fiberglass door is competing against that commodity "wood" door at the bottom of the market. It is not competing against a true timber door. And when you compare fiberglass against that lower tier, fiberglass looks great. When you compare it against solid wood built the right way, the story changes.
The FrameworkThe Five Factors That Actually Matter
Five things determine whether a front door was the right choice: how long it lasts, what it costs, how it looks and feels, whether you can fix it when something goes wrong, and how it performs thermally. Everything else is noise.
Durability & Lifespan
Durability. Fiberglass doors are commonly cited at 20 to 30-plus years, with some manufacturers floating 50-year marketing claims. A solid wood door, properly built and maintained, can serve 30 to 100 years or more. The critical word in that sentence is "maintained." A neglected wood door exposed to weather without a functional finish or overhang can fail in under a decade. Fiberglass doesn't care about neglect the same way. It won't rot. That's a real advantage, and pretending otherwise would be dishonest. But a fiberglass door that takes a hard impact or develops structural cracking at the stile is generally a replacement job. A wood door in the same situation is a repair job, and that difference compounds over decades.
Warranties tell the same story from the manufacturer's side. Major fiberglass brands offer lifetime limited warranties on the slab — Therma-Tru is the biggest name here, and their warranty page confirms the lifetime coverage. But lifetime limited means limited. Read the exclusions on components, finish, and glass, and the real commitment narrows considerably. Solid wood door warranties from mass-market manufacturers are often shorter, typically 1 to 10 years, precisely because wood responds to its environment and warranty exclusions for moisture damage and warping are broad. A custom door builder's warranty is different — it's a relationship with the shop that built it, not a call-center claim process.
Cost: Upfront vs. Lifetime
Cost. Entry-level fiberglass doors run from a few hundred dollars for the slab to roughly $3,500 installed for a premium pre-hung unit. Solid wood doors built from true timber start higher because the material and labor are fundamentally different. RealCraft entry doors start at $1,615 for the [Albion Shaker Three Panel](/collections/front-entry-doors) and climb from there — fully custom designs like the [Cambria Basket Weave](/collections/modern-front-doors) surpass $8,000. Installation costs for wood run equal to or somewhat higher than fiberglass because wood is heavier and may require more fitting work. But cost framed as purchase price alone misses the point. A wood door that gets refinished three times over 60 years costs less over its life than two fiberglass replacements, and that's before you account for what a fiberglass door that can't be repaired actually costs when it fails.
Appearance: What Your Hands Actually Feel
Appearance. This is where the comparison gets physical, and it's the place fiberglass cannot win. Premium fiberglass doors from brands like Therma-Tru use deep-embossed wood-grain skins and gel-stain systems that have improved dramatically. From the street, they can pass. Up close, the grain pattern repeats. There's no ray figure. No medullary fleck in the quartersawn white oak. No mineral streaks in the walnut. No figure that varies board to board because no actual tree produced it. [Solid wood across over 20 species](/pages/wood-species), from the golden caramel of Western Red Cedar to the deep chocolate of Sapele Mahogany to the pale precision of Maple, produces surfaces that a mold simply cannot replicate. Your front door is the first thing anyone touches when they enter your home. It should feel like the thing it claims to be.

Repairability: The Sleeper Advantage
Repairability. This is the sleeper advantage, and it almost never appears in competitor comparisons. Solid wood is repairable. Sand out scratches. Plane and refinish. Patch dents with wood filler or, for larger damage, fit a Dutchman patch and make it disappear under a fresh coat of stain. A solid wood door with mortise and tenon joinery can be refinished, repaired, and restored repeatedly over its life. Fiberglass can be patched with epoxy repair kits for small dings and scratches. But a cracked fiberglass stile, a shattered corner, deep UV degradation — that door is done. You cannot plane it. You cannot structurally rework it. You replace it. Repair kits run $20 to $60 at the hardware store and they're a temporary patch, not a restoration. A refinished wood door costs more to restore but the result is a door that looks new, not a door that looks patched.
Energy Performance: The Honest Numbers
Energy performance. This is the one category where fiberglass has a clear, measurable edge, and it's important to handle it honestly. A foam-core fiberglass door achieves R-5 to R-6 depending on the foam density and slab construction. A solid wood slab, at R-2 to R-3 for a standard 1-3/4 inch door, is genuinely less insulating by material physics alone. But the framing matters: neither slab alone makes an entry energy-efficient. Air leakage around the door, the quality of the weatherstripping, and the presence and type of glass are what dominate real-world heat loss. A beautifully built solid wood door with tight weatherstripping and properly sealed glass can outperform a leaky foam-core door that's poorly installed. The whole-assembly U-factor matters more than the slab's R-value, and most comparison articles skip this entirely in favor of a single number that makes fiberglass look dominant. If fiberglass manufacturers lead with slab R-value and not whole-door U-factor, ask yourself what they're not showing you.
Credit Where DueWhat Fiberglass Does Better
Credibility requires conceding what's true. Fiberglass has three genuine strengths, and in certain situations, any honest builder should acknowledge them.
Moisture resistance is the first and strongest. Fiberglass is dimensionally stable. It will not swell, cup, or bow with humidity changes. It will not rot. In the Pacific Northwest, where Seattle sees ~39 inches of rain (NOAA 1991-2020 normal) annually west of the Cascades, that matters. A fiberglass door on a fully exposed, south-facing entry with no porch or overhang will handle years of direct rain without structural change. Wood in the same situation would demand a rigorous finish schedule, a rot-resistant species like White Oak or Western Red Cedar, and ideally a protective overhang. Skip any of those, and the wood door will fail.
Lower upfront cost is the second advantage. If your budget is tight and the door must go in now, fiberglass gets you an entry that looks credible and functions for a couple of decades. That's not a small thing. Faster installation is the third. Fiberglass pre-hung units go in fast. Production builders love them for exactly this reason — less labor, shorter timeline, predictable result.
Those are real advantages, and a door company that only builds solid wood should be able to say so without flinching.
The DifferenceWhat Solid Wood Does That Fiberglass Will Never Match
Now the other side.
Real wood grain is unrepeatable. Every board is a record of growing conditions, mineral content, and decades of tree growth. No mold recreates that. When you choose a wood species, from the closed-grain durability of White Oak to the rich reddish-brown of Sapele Mahogany to the pale, even character of Maple, you're choosing a material with identity. Fiberglass offers three to five grain patterns, each an approximation of something real. Close your eyes and run your hand across a solid wood door — then do the same on fiberglass. One is warm and textured with actual grain topography. The other is an impression of texture pressed into plastic composite. They do not feel the same, and the difference registers instantly.
Custom sizing is a structural advantage, not a cosmetic one. Wood doors can be built to any opening. Fiberglass doors come from steel molds in standard sizes. Non-standard or old-house openings, common throughout the Pacific Northwest, demand either a custom wood door or an expensive fiberglass modification that can compromise the slab's structure. RealCraft builds every door to the exact dimensions of the opening it will fill, right here in Gig Harbor, Washington. That's not a marketing claim. It's a consequence of working with solid lumber instead of molded composite.
Longevity, properly framed, belongs to wood. A fiberglass door that serves 25 years and gets replaced is now in a landfill. A solid wood door that serves 60 years and gets refinished twice is still on the house. That's not just economics. It's the difference between a product and a fixture. The solid wood entry door becomes part of the home in a way a replaceable composite door does not.

RegionalThe Pacific Northwest Factor
Where you live changes the math.
In the Pacific Northwest, west of the Cascades, moisture is the dominant environmental challenge. Rain. Humidity. Mild winters with long wet seasons. Architectural styles reflect this: Craftsman homes with wide porches and protective overhangs that shelter the entry. Northwest Modern designs that pair clean lines with natural materials. Mid-Century homes where wood entries with geometric glass are the standard, not the upgrade.

How to Choose
The right door for your home depends on questions most comparison articles never ask. Here are the ones that matter.
Is your entry protected? If a porch or roof overhang shields the door from direct rain and sun, wood's maintenance demands are manageable and its longevity advantages kick in. Fully exposed entries need either a fiberglass door or the discipline to maintain a wood door's finish on schedule.
How long will you own the home? If you're planning to stay for decades, the repairability and refinishability of solid wood become economic advantages. If you're moving in five years, fiberglass at a lower upfront cost may be the right short-term math. Different timelines, different math.
Do you care about authenticity? Some homeowners want the door to feel substantial, to age naturally, to carry the character of a real material. Others want a door that looks good, functions, and doesn't demand attention. Neither answer is wrong. But a solid wood door is for the first person, and if you're reading this far, you're probably that person.
What's your tolerance for maintenance? A solid wood door needs its finish refreshed periodically — more often with dark stains in full sun, less frequently with lighter finishes on protected entries. Fiberglass is essentially maintenance-free beyond cleaning. If the thought of refinishing a door every few years feels like burden, the honest answer is fiberglass.

FAQSolid Wood vs. Fiberglass FAQ
What does "solid wood" actually mean?
True solid wood — true timber — is milled from solid pieces of raw lumber comprising the full thickness of the door. No fillers, no veneers over MDF, no foam cores. If you're not sure whether a door is real wood, here's how to tell.
Can you repair a fiberglass door?
Small dings can be patched with epoxy kits ($20–60). But a cracked stile, shattered corner, or deep UV degradation means replacement. Solid wood can be sanded, patched, and refinished indefinitely.
Is fiberglass more energy efficient than solid wood?
On paper, yes — a foam-core fiberglass door achieves R-5 to R-6. A solid wood slab runs R-2 to R-3. In practice, air leakage around the door and weatherstripping quality dominate real-world performance. A tightly sealed wood door can outperform a leaky fiberglass one.
What wood species performs best in the Pacific Northwest?
White Oak resists water penetration thanks to natural tyloses that block its pores. Western Red Cedar is native to the region and naturally rot-resistant. Sapele Mahogany brings interlocking grain stability. See all twenty species.
How long does a solid wood entry door last?
30 to 100-plus years with proper finishing and maintenance. A well-built solid wood door can be refinished repeatedly — the door itself doesn't wear out, the finish does.
